Elias Loomis
Elias Loomis
(August 7, 1811 – August 15, 1889) was an American mathematician. He served as a professor of mathematics and natural philosophy at
Western Reserve College
(now
Case Western Reserve University
), the
University of the City of New York
and
Yale University
. During his tenure at Western Reserve College in 1838, he established the
Loomis Observatory
, currently the second oldest
observatory
in the
United States
.
